The video explores quantum field theory, focusing on vacuum energy and its discrepancies with measured values. It discusses the Heisenberg uncertainty principle, quantum oscillators, and the concept of infinite vacuum energy. The video also examines the implications of vacuum energy on general relativity, including gravitational effects and universe expansion. Supersymmetry and dark energy are introduced as potential solutions to the vacuum catastrophe, highlighting the challenges in reconciling theory with observations.
